Output 1b62ecf64d9802ac3c5be90fb7e9800ea08c382802d40a2c28a4fbf0a4f2a8cf:0

value
5958912
script pubkey
OP_0 OP_PUSHBYTES_20 5d42947e78c6e6225d142f335709ba03e3614f96
address
bc1qt4pfglnccmnzyhg59ue4wzd6q03kznukx8edqg
transaction
1b62ecf64d9802ac3c5be90fb7e9800ea08c382802d40a2c28a4fbf0a4f2a8cf
confirmations
26855
spent
true